What happens in individual therapy?
During your first session, your therapist will get to know you, your goals, and what brought you to therapy. From there, you’ll work together to uncover patterns, strengthen emotional resilience, and develop new ways of thinking and coping. Sessions are always collaborative and guided by your needs and pace.

Rooted in empathy. Backed by evidence.
Our clinicians use evidence-based approaches like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) skills, and trauma-informed care. Whether you need tools to manage anxiety or want to explore deeper patterns, we adapt our methods to meet your needs in a warm, nonjudgmental environment.
